European markets opened slightly higher on Friday, as investors reacted to quarter-point interest rate cuts from the U.S. Federal Reserve and Bank of England.
European markets were slightly higher on Friday, as investors monitored corporate results and reacted to quarter-point interest rate cuts from the U.S. Federal Reserve and Bank of England.The pan-European Stoxx 600 traded up around 0.1% shortly after the opening bell, with sectors and major bourses pointing in opposite directions.Germany's DAX index closed the previous session up 1.
